Verilog不错的,类似C的风格。各有优点。
现在都在开始推system C了,技术发展太快。
关键还是自己好用,用熟一样比全部都只学个皮毛好。
众多硬件描述语言,你使用哪一种,该选用哪一种?
在最近的一个项目中,打算把电路中的一些零碎东西用一个GAL器件来集成,在向代理商寻价的过程中,对方向我推荐了Lattice的一款廉价CPLD,二者价差不大,考虑到价格的确不错,而且Lattice也是早期专业做PLD的厂家之一,当然还有CPLD的前景,于是我接受了它,并开始熟悉它的开发环境,由于我要做的是一个很简单的东西,所以用原理图输入方式很快搞定,现在,我认为非常有必要掌握一种HDL语言,经过查询,目前的HDL语言种类繁多,使我有些忙然,不知到该学哪种好?
1、ABLE语言,以前在学校简单学过,在搞GAL时也用它做过简单的应用,但那是很久以前的事,如今已经忘得差不多了,在我的记意中,它好象比较简单,也容易掌握,但据我看好象不是很流行,不是何原因?
2、VHDL语言,应该是目前使用者最多的HDL吧?也是最早被制订为标准的硬件描述语言。但不知它特点是什么?主要适合于什么样的应用?
3、Verilog HDL,据说是第二个被制订为标准的硬件描述语言,与VHDL相比有后来居上的势态,谁能说说它的特点及应用场合?
以上三种HDL在Lattice的开发环境下都被支持;
不知Altera、Xilinx等公司的开发环境支持哪些HDL语言?还有如AHDL、Superlog、SystemC、Cynlib C++、C Level等等,不知它们的情况怎样?
恳请大家谈谈自己的看法,也许就是你的一句话,让一位甚至很多刚刚进入PLD领域工程师少走不少弯路!
Verilog不错的,类似C的风格。各有优点。
现在都在开始推system C了,技术发展太快。
关键还是自己好用,用熟一样比全部都只学个皮毛好。
时段 | 个数 |
---|---|
{{f.startingTime}}点 - {{f.endTime}}点 | {{f.fileCount}} |
200字以内,仅用于支线交流,主线讨论请采用回复功能。